当前位置:   article > 正文

Pandas学习笔记——新建文件_pandas新建excel文件

pandas新建excel文件

1.1 新建空白Excel文件并保存

  1. # 新建Excel文件
  2. path = r'F:/pandas/newdata.xlsx'
  3. data = pd.DataFrame({'id': [1, 2, 3], '姓名': ['李四', '老王', '张三']}) # 二维数据表
  4. data.to_excel(path)
  5. print('新建文件newdata.xlsx成功')

1.2 新建文件的同时写入数据

用多维数组字典生成DataFrame,多维数组的长度必须相同。

  1. # 新建Excel文件同时写入数据
  2. path = r'F:/pandas/newdata.xlsx'
  3. data = pd.DataFrame({'id': [1, 2, 3], '姓名': ['李四', '老王', '张三']}) # 二维数据表
  4. data.to_excel(path)
  5. print('新建文件newdata.xlsx成功')

1.3 设置索引

有两种方法设置索引:

① 创建DataFrame时传递索引参数,index的长度必须与数组一致。

  1. # 新建空白Excel文件
  2. path = r'F:/pandas/newdata.xlsx'
  3. data = pd.DataFrame({'姓名': ['李四', '老王', '张三']},index=[1,2,3]) # 二维数据表
  4. data.to_excel(path)
  5. print('新建空白文件newdata.xlsx成功')

② set_index()

  1. # 新建空白Excel文件
  2. path = r'F:/pandas/newdata.xlsx'
  3. data = pd.DataFrame({'index'=[1,2,3],'姓名': ['李四', '老王', '张三']}) # 二维数据表
  4. data.set_index('id', inplace=True)
  5. data.to_excel(path)
  6. print('新建空白文件newdata.xlsx成功')

最后效果如下:

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/繁依Fanyi0/article/detail/69645
推荐阅读
相关标签
  

闽ICP备14008679号